Output 4ebda86c41bdc8452e7a6ed894039b33efafd267d96ccdb184d2b25dc5a11bb9:0

value
32067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660ee238223fed89c1f6fe9bda03d7de98a663a9 OP_EQUAL
address
3AzegFDVnLK6mNB8TcW4WZ2C824BV4d3W3
transaction
4ebda86c41bdc8452e7a6ed894039b33efafd267d96ccdb184d2b25dc5a11bb9
confirmations
270
spent
true